Details about Women's Issues

Adult women often seek therapy to address the emotional, relational, and societal complexities that surface throughout different phases of life. Whether juggling work and caregiving responsibilities, navigating fertility or health challenges, or dealing with gender-based discrimination or microaggressions, the cumulative stress can become overwhelming. These pressures frequently manifest as anxiety, depression, self-doubt, chronic guilt, or a sense of emotional depletion, especially when support systems are limited or societal expectations feel impossible to meet.

 

Therapists at Westside Behavioral Care offer a safe, validating environment where women can process these challenges and reconnect with themselves. Therapy may center on topics such as emotional labor, people-pleasing, perfectionism, boundary-setting, or healing from childhood or relational trauma. For some clients, sessions focus on self-identity and empowerment after years of prioritizing others. Others may explore intergenerational patterns, cultural expectations, or the psychological effects of workplace inequality and caregiving burnout. We also work with women navigating reproductive transitions such as infertility, miscarriage, postpartum depression, or menopause, recognizing the emotional and hormonal layers that accompany each experience.

 

Treatment plans are tailored to each client’s goals, and often incorporate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) for managing internalized negative beliefs,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) for coping with uncertainty and change, and mindfulness-based techniques for stress reduction. Many of our providers also integrate feminist therapy principles, body image work, trauma-informed care, or solution-focused strategies depending on each woman’s needs and lived experience.
